I also have tried the compatibility options... none of them work. I'm going to try this reply I found below out and see if it does the trick. The instructions below I know work for Vista, Windows 7, 8, and 8.1. Hopefully it will for windows 10.

The game was not allowed to create an options.ini in the C:\Users\[your login name]\AppData\Roaming\My Battle for Middle-earth(tm) Files folder. So if you don't see an options.ini you'll have to create one yourself... it should contain the following lines:


AllHealthBars = yes
AlternateMouseSetup = no
AmbientVolume = 50
AudioLOD = High
Brightness = 50
FixedStaticGameLOD = UltraHigh
FlashTutorial = 0
HasSeenLogoMovies = yes
HeatEffects = yes
IdealStaticGameLOD = Low
IsThreadedLoad = yes
MovieVolume = 70
MusicVolume = 70
Resolution = 1680 1050
SFXVolume = 70
ScrollFactor = 50
StaticGameLOD = UltraHigh
TimesInGame = 54
UnitDecals = yes
UseEAX3 = no
VoiceVolume = 70

Then run the compatibility mode for Windows Vista (Service Pack 2). It auto defaults to Windows XP (Service Pack 3) when you the program choose the compatibility mode. I've done this trick on two different computers and it works.

I was able to make it work. You have to follow the following steps:

1. Create an options.ini in the C:\Users\[your login name]\AppData\Roaming\My Battle for Middle-earth(tm) Files folder. You do this by opening up notepad and pasting the below text. You can change the resolution if you want.

AllHealthBars = yes
AlternateMouseSetup = no
AmbientVolume = 50
AudioLOD = High
Brightness = 50
FixedStaticGameLOD = UltraHigh
FlashTutorial = 0
HasSeenLogoMovies = yes
HeatEffects = yes
IdealStaticGameLOD = Low
IsThreadedLoad = yes
MovieVolume = 70
MusicVolume = 70
Resolution = 1680 1050
SFXVolume = 70
ScrollFactor = 50
StaticGameLOD = UltraHigh
TimesInGame = 54
UnitDecals = yes
UseEAX3 = no
VoiceVolume = 70

2. Save the file as options.ini.

3. Run BFME2 under Windows Vista (Service Pack 2) Compatibility Mode.

I have done this twice now and it should work. Good luck.

(Side Note: If you want to play Rise of the Witch King. Follow the same steps above but place the options.ini in the Rise of the Witch King directory instead.)
